I've eaten here a few times in the last couple of months at the Magazine and State location. Parking is ok. The restaurant is clean and the staff (everytime), is friendly, helpful and polite. The first time I ate here with my girl (Babycakes) in December, I had an Italian Deli sandwich. It was very tasty! Crunchy, flavorful focaccia bread with quality ingredients of turkey, ham, pancetta, provolone cheese and dill aioli with a cold salad of cherry tomatoes, capers, fresh basil, red onions and olive oil. Sizewise, I would have liked a larger sandwich, but given the ingredients and price, I guess it was about right. Babycakes won the evening with an appetizer of Roasted Cauliflower with roasted garlic and a soft herbed goat cheese butter, and an Italian Salami salad of Mixed greens, marinated artichokes, red onions, roasted cherry tomatoes, capers and walnuts mixed with strips of hard salami, served with basil pesto vinaigrette. The appetizer was so good, Babycakes only gave me a bite and ate the rest herself (grrrr)! I enjoyed it so much, I came back for lunch the next day, and ordered the same app and salad for myself!! Delicious! Last week we returned, to find out the Roasted Cauliflower appetizer was seasonal and not offered at that time (darn it). I ordered a gumbo pizza. It was ok. I didn't like the Andouille sausage (kind of greasy) and pickled okra I felt didn't go with the pizza. Babycakes ordered a Eggplant Reginelli appetizer (Whole roasted eggplant with olive oil, fresh garlic and fontina, topped with a soft herbed goat cheese butter). It was just ok.
